Affected products
2017 | PORSCHE | PANAMERA, 2018 | PORSCHE | PANAMERA, 2019 | PORSCHE | CAYENNE, 2020 | PORSCHE | CAYENNE
Issue
On certain vehicles, the red brake wear warning light may not come on when the brake pads require replacement. This can happen when the instrument cluster display is set to the Map or Night Vision mode. Canadian regulations require the warning indicator to stay on when the brakes are worn. Note: This recall replaces Transport Canada recall 2019-078. Vehicles that were repaired under that recall also require this repair.
Safety risk
Driving a vehicle with brakes that are worn out could increase the risk of a crash.
Corrective actions
Porsche will notify owners by mail and instruct them to take their vehicle to a dealer to update the instrument cluster software.
